I have not been able to open DGN files generated by Global Mapper 8 and 9 in Google Earth (Pro) (even after several attempts) which has an Import menu for DGN and other files. Further When I generate contours in Global Mapper and export Kmz, the contour labels ( 25m ....) are always loaded in the side bar and main Google Earth shows only lines , but people want the label along side the contour as is common in any contour map

    I'm guessing that Google Earth only has the ability to import old DGN v7 files and not the new DGN v8 format files exported by Global Mapper.

    For the contour labels, unfortunately the KMZ format does not have support for displaying line labels along those lines. Labels can only be done via a point spot label. You can of course Ctrl+Left Click on a line feature to get its information, including label and other attributes.
